The purpose of this document is to provide interested parties with information to enable them to prepare and submit a proposal for the Brighter Futures Initiative (BFI) Program in counties outside of Region 3 (Milwaukee). BFI promotes healthy families and youth; school success for youth; youth safety in their families and communities; and, successful navigation from adolescence to adulthood. The Initiative supports evidence-based prevention strategies and a positive youth development approach and focuses on the legislative outcomes set forth in s. 48.545, Wis. Stats., Brighter Futures Initiative. Eligible applicants must fall within the two applicant types identified in Section 5.1, and must be: • County or tribal department of social service; • County or tribal department of human services; • Tribal child welfare agencies; or • Community mental health, developmental disabilities or alcoholism and drug abuse service programs operating in counties other than a county having a population of 750,000 or more. Joint applications from two or more eligible applicants will be accepted; the primary applicant must be a county department or tribe.
